WARNING:
Failure to follow the manufacturers
recommended installation method may result in
damage to the enamel surface.
!
Do not use sharp objects or metal tools when
handling the bath, especially around the rim area.
!
Use a clear protective plastic film over tub rim as
well as the bottom of tub to safeguard from dirt and
silicone during the installation process.
!
For correct installation, bath rim should not come in
direct contact with the walls or horizontal surfaces to
avoid transmission of noise and vibration as well as
potential cracks in the enamel finish.
!
The necessary gap between bath rim and the wall is
2 mm horizontally and 4 mm vertically. Refer to
figures 1, 2, and 3 below.
!
Before setting-in the bath, apply a sanitary quality
silicone filler on all surfaces to come in contact with
the bath rim.
!
Set the bath in its correct position.

B. Partially Install Bath Drain
Install the drain on the bath according to the drain
manufacturers instructions.
INSTALL THE BATH
INSTALL THE BATH
A1. Installation of Bath with Adjustable
Slide the new bath into position.
Insert the drain tailpiece into the trap.
Level the bath by positioning metal shims and bricks
under the bath feet, and ensure there is enough space
for the drain. Attention: The metal shims are necessary
to avoid cracking of bricks. Check for level along the
top of the side of the bath and across the drain end.
The bath may have to be moved in and out of the
recess area until it is shimmed properly, if the support
feet are not accessible from the back or side.
